Ibn Abbas reported that when the Prophet صلی اللہ علیہ وسلم was questioned about the offspring of polytheists, he said: Allah knows best about what they were doing.

Read More..Aishah, mother of the believers, said: The Prophet صلی اللہ علیہ وسلم was invited to the funeral of a boy who belonged to the ANSAR and I said; Messenger of Allah! This one is blessed, for he has done no evil, nor has he known it. He replied: It may be otherwise, Aishah, for Allah created Paradise and created those who will go to it, and He created it for them when they were still in their father’s loins; and he created hell and created those who will go to it, and created it for them when they were still in their father’s loins.
